The increasing order of the reactivity of the following halides for the `S_(N)` 1 reaction is
`underset((I))underset(Cl)underset(|)(CH_(3))CHCH_(2)CH_(3) " " underset((II))(CH_(3)CH_(2)CH_(2)Cl) " " underset((III))(p-H_(3)CO-C_(6)H_(4)-CH_(2)Cl`

A

`III gt II gt I`

B

`II gt I gt III`

C

`I gt III gt II`

D

`II gt III gt I`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B
